Fervo Energy, a company backed by Bill Gates, has seen its stock price soar by 35% following a successful upsized initial public offering (IPO). The surge reflects strong investor interest in the renewable energy sector, particularly in companies focused on innovative geothermal technologies.

This IPO marks a significant milestone for Fervo Energy, which aims to capitalize on the growing demand for sustainable energy solutions. The increased capital from the IPO will likely enhance its ability to scale operations and accelerate project development, positioning the company favorably within the competitive landscape of clean energy.
